Honored: The Rapid City Comfort Inn & Suites won the Inn of the Year award from Choice Hotels International, franchisor of the Comfort Inn brand. The award was announced during the company's annual convention in Florida. Choice Hotels annually presents the Inn of the Year award to hotels that demonstrate lodging excellence. The best of each brand is selected by reviewing properties' guest satisfaction and quality assurance review scores.
